Psalm 119:65-96 - Teach Me Knowledge and Good Judgment

As we continue to walk through Psalm 119 today, we can learn many things that can both encourage us and provide us with good judgment for our lives in the many areas we come in  contact with. Whether that is home, school, work, church, friends, family, entertainment, sports, etc. 

Psalm 119:69,70 - "Though the arrogant has smeared me with lies, I keep your precepts with all my heart. 70-Their hearts are callous and unfeeling, but I delight in your law"

The author is sharing with us that the crafty yet hatred of the wicked, who tries their best to slander him, so far in turning him away from the Lord, actually binds him closer to God's Word, which means these wicked individuals are too senseless in their own sin to appreciate how much God really does love us.  So think about this statement with your own life.  No matter who tries to pull you back into sin, doing their best to cause you pain and pull you away from your beliefs, if you have a relationship with the Lord, your desire is to pull yourself up, shake off this disbelief and desire more from the Lord.  If it is your desire to be closer to God, He will not leave you or forsake you. 

Psalm 119:82 - "My eyes fail, looking for your promise; I say, 'When will you comfort me?'"

"My eyes fail, looking for your promise" means you have a yearning desire for the Word.  Sometimes the Lord does not give us what our heart most wants.  This is when it can become the hardest.  When our eyes fail to see what His Word teaches us, we must have faith in Him, that He will lead us and guide us to what He believes is the best thing for our walk with Him.  We must have faith in the Lord for our future.  When we are ready, God will show us the way.

Psalm 119:89-91 - "Your word, O LORD, is eternal, it stands firm in the heavens.  90-Your faithfulness continues through all generations; you established the earth, and it endures. 
91-Your laws endure to this day, for all things serve you"

In all changes God's Word remains firm (1 Peter 1:25-"... but the Word of the Lord stands forever").  Like the heavens, it continually demonstrates God's unfailing power and unchanging care.

  1. Psalm 119:65-96 / New International Version

    ט Teth

    65 Do good to your servant
    according to your word, O Lord.
    66 Teach me knowledge and good judgment,
    for I believe in your commands.
    67 Before I was afflicted I went astray,
    but now I obey your word.
    68 You are good, and what you do is good;
    teach me your decrees.
    69 Though the arrogant have smeared me with lies,
    I keep your precepts with all my heart.
    70 Their hearts are callous and unfeeling,
    but I delight in your law.
    71 It was good for me to be afflicted
    so that I might learn your decrees.
    72 The law from your mouth is more precious to me
    than thousands of pieces of silver and gold.

    י Yodh

    73 Your hands made me and formed me;
    give me understanding to learn your commands.
    74 May those who fear you rejoice when they see me,
    for I have put my hope in your word.
    75 I know, O Lord, that your laws are righteous,
    and that in faithfulness you have afflicted me.
    76 May your unfailing love be my comfort,
    according to your promise to your servant.
    77 Let your compassion come to me that I may live,
    for your law is my delight.
    78 May the arrogant be put to shame for wronging me without cause;
    but I will meditate on your precepts.
    79 May those who fear you turn to me,
    those who understand your statutes.
    80 May my heart be blameless toward your decrees,
    that I may not be put to shame.

    כ Kaph

    81 My soul faints with longing for your salvation,
    but I have put my hope in your word.
    82 My eyes fail, looking for your promise;
    I say, “When will you comfort me?”
    83 Though I am like a wineskin in the smoke,
    I do not forget your decrees.
    84 How long must your servant wait?
    When will you punish my persecutors?
    85 The arrogant dig pitfalls for me,
    contrary to your law.
    86 All your commands are trustworthy;
    help me, for men persecute me without cause.
    87 They almost wiped me from the earth,
    but I have not forsaken your precepts.
    88 Preserve my life according to your love,
    and I will obey the statutes of your mouth.

    ל Lamedh

    89 Your word, O Lord, is eternal;
    it stands firm in the heavens.
    90 Your faithfulness continues through all generations;
    you established the earth, and it endures.
    91 Your laws endure to this day,
    for all things serve you.
    92 If your law had not been my delight,
    I would have perished in my affliction.
    93 I will never forget your precepts,
    for by them you have preserved my life.
    94 Save me, for I am yours;
    I have sought out your precepts.
    95 The wicked are waiting to destroy me,
    but I will ponder your statutes.
    96 To all perfection I see a limit,
    but your commands are boundless.
